Keir Starmer Faces Leadership Crisis Over Peter Mandelson's Vetting Issues

UK Prime Minister Keir Starmer is under scrutiny following revelations that Peter Mandelson was denied security clearance for the ambassador role in Washington. Starmer claimed he was unaware of the Foreign Office's decision until recently, which contradicts his previous statements to Parliament about the vetting process. The fallout has led to the resignation of Olly Robbins, the Foreign Office's top civil servant. Starmer expressed his anger, calling the situation 'staggering' and 'unforgivable.' This ongoing scandal could jeopardize Starmer's leadership, especially with upcoming elections in May 2026.
